In this study a numerical design of a new noninvasive hyperthermia applicator system capable of effectively heating deep seated brain tumor using inexpensive, simple, and easy to fabricate components. The proposed system is composed of a microstrip antenna, an ellipsoidal reflector and a head model. The irradiating antenna is placed at one of the foci of the ellipsoidal reflector while the brain tumor is placed at the other focus.
